A Toast to History: Uncorking the Story of Wine
An apt gift for oenophiles everywhere, this book includes chapters on the development of wine production, from the use of casks to bottles to the switch from feet to presses, as well as tracing the global shift of wine production from traditional wine-producing regions to emerging wine exporters.

About The Author
Ruth Ball
Ruth Ball is the author of Rough Spirits and High Society and the founder of Alchemist Dreams, a company dedicated to handmade liqueurs that are blended to order.
